Buying Guide

When it comes to choosing the best microwave surge protector, there are several factors to consider. We have used and tested various surge protectors to identify the key features that make them effective.

Surge Protection Rating

One of the most important factors to consider when choosing a microwave surge protector is the surge protection rating. This rating indicates the level of protection that the surge protector provides against power surges. A higher rating means that the surge protector can handle more voltage spikes, providing better protection for your microwave and other appliances.

Number of Outlets

Another important factor to consider is the number of outlets on the surge protector. If you have multiple appliances that you want to protect, you’ll need a surge protector with multiple outlets. However, keep in mind that the more outlets there are, the larger the surge protector will be, which may make it less portable.

Power Capacity

The power capacity of the surge protector is also an important consideration. This refers to the amount of power that the surge protector can handle without overheating or tripping a circuit breaker. If you have a high-powered microwave or other appliances, you’ll need a surge protector with a higher power capacity to avoid tripping the circuit breaker.

How do surge protectors with circuit breakers differ from those without?

Surge protectors with circuit breakers are designed to protect appliances from overloading the electrical circuit. When an appliance draws too much power, the circuit breaker will trip to prevent damage to the appliance or the electrical system. Surge protectors without circuit breakers do not have this feature and may not provide adequate protection in some situations.

How does a power strip differ from a surge protector, and when is each appropriate?

A power strip is a device that provides multiple outlets for plugging in appliances. It does not provide any surge protection and is not designed to protect appliances from power surges. A surge protector, on the other hand, is designed to protect appliances from power surges and spikes. It is appropriate to use a power strip when you need additional outlets, and a surge protector when you need to protect your appliances from power surges.
